Political Quotes

On the recordApril 20, 1994
I wanted to publicly identify myself and appreciate the gentleman's courage and his willingness to be the conscience of this Congress on this issue. There are people being slaughtered and, at a minimum, we ought to lift the arms embargo. I was in Mostar earlier this year. They have been slaughtered there, and they had no arms. I just want to commend the gentleman. I would hope that this administration will listen. We are not going to send troops. We know that. At a minimum, we should lift the arms embargo. When we were going through the same problem back in 1976, the French came to our assistance and helped us. At a minimum, we should help the Croats and the Muslins who are fighting valiantly but without arms against the onslaught of the Serbs. I just want to commend the gentleman and thank him for his comments and his leadership.
Said by
Frank Wolf
Republican · Virginia

Editor's note · Context

Addressing the need to lift the arms embargo during a discussion on the conflict in Bosnia.
